WebAug 18, 2006 · Compared to raytraced soft shadows from an area light, ambient occlusion can provide similar looking shading in your scene, but usually takes less time to render. … WebDec 7, 2024 · FidelityFX Shadow Denoiser. A spatio-temporal denoiser for raytraced soft shadows. It is intended to be used on a shadow mask that was created from at most one jittered shadow ray per pixel. It makes use of a tile classification pass to skip work on areas without spatial variance in the shadow mask. In cases of low temporal sample counts, the ...

WebIn Unreal Engine, this is called Distance Field Shadows (DFS). To calculate shadowing, a ray is traced from the point being shaded through the scene's Signed Distance Fields (SDF) toward each light.
